FAQ
How do you detect gas leaks in Springfield, Massachusetts?
Gas leak detection involves several methods, including using electronic gas detectors that measure gas concentrations, applying soapy water to suspected areas and looking for bubbling, or relying on physical signs like the distinctive rotten-egg smell added to utility gas. In Springfield, our trained technicians employ these techniques to accurately locate leaks and ensure your safety.
What are the first signs of a gas leak in Springfield, Massachusetts?
Early signs of a gas leak include a persistent sulfur or rotten-egg odor, a hissing sound near gas lines, dead plants in the vicinity of pipes, or physical symptoms like dizziness or nausea. If you notice any of these in your Springfield home, evacuate immediately and call professionals for gas leak detection.
How can I check for a gas leak at home in Springfield before professionals arrive?
Before technicians arrive, you can do a preliminary check by listening for hissing sounds and smelling for sulfur or rotten-egg odor. You can also apply soapy water to suspected joints and look for bubbles. However, do not use any electronic devices or switches, as they could ignite the gas. For any suspected leak in Springfield, vacate the area and contact emergency services.
